Chan decides to make a positive change in his life. instead of going to work with a frown on his face, he will force himself to

smile when he walks into work. according to ________, by altering his behavior chan is likely to change his negative attitude about work. the foot-in-the-door phenomenon informational social influence cognitive dissonance attribution theory

Answer:

The attitudes-follow-behavior principle.

Explanation:

The attitudes-follow-behavior principle: The attitude-follow-behavior principle is defined as an individual can't control his or her feelings directly yet he or she can influence the feelings by changing or altering a particular behavior.

According to this principle, the more an individual feels dissonance i.e, the conflicts between thoughts and behavior the more he or she is directed towards finding a consistency, for example, changing one's attitude or behavior to explain certain acts.

In the question above, Chan is likely to change his negative attitude towards the work through the attitude-follow-behavior principle.

Consider the following statement: "Health psychology investigates how people grow and change across the life span. Community psy
miskamm [114]

Answer:

The correct one is the definition of <u>community psychology</u>.

Explanation:

Community psychology studies how the environment affects individual and community functioning, that is, how the interdependence and interaction of individuals and groups with social, historical, cultural (and other) contexts influence social health. The purpose of community psychology is to prevent dysfunction while promoting wellness, empowerment and social justice. As we can see, this is the same as saying, "Community psychology aims to create healthy social and physical environments." Therefore, the definition of community psychology is correct.

On the other hand, the definition "Health psychology investigates how people grow and change across the life span" is incorrect. Health psychology is basically the study of how psychological, biological, cultural, and behavioral aspects influence health and illness.
